Stephen Smalley wrote:
> On Fri, 2008-06-13 at 11:43 -0400, Joshua Brindle wrote:
>> This patch addresses a shadowed var that prevents libsepol from being built with DEBUG=1
>>
>> Signed-off-by: Joshua Brindle <method@manicmethod.com>
>>
>> ---
>>
>> Index: libsepol/src/write.c
>> ===================================================================
>> --- libsepol/src/write.c	(revision 2908)
>> +++ libsepol/src/write.c	(working copy)
>> @@ -1625,10 +1625,10 @@
>>  	if (p->policyvers < POLICYDB_VERSION_PERMISSIVE &&
>>  	    p->policy_type == POLICY_KERN) {
>>  		ebitmap_node_t *tnode;
>> -		unsigned int i;
>> +		unsigned int j;
>>  
>> -		ebitmap_for_each_bit(&p->permissive_map, tnode, i) {
>> -			if (ebitmap_node_get_bit(tnode, i)) {
>> +		ebitmap_for_each_bit(&p->permissive_map, tnode, j) {
>> +			if (ebitmap_node_get_bit(tnode, j)) {
>>  				WARN(fp->handle, "Warning! Policy version %d cannot "
>>  				     "support permissive types, but some were defined",
>>  				     p->policyvers);
> 
> Any particular reason we can't just use the local var from the outer
> scope?
> 


good point, I didn't really look at how i was being used. This uses i from the outer scope and adds -Wshadow to library and checkpolicy makefiles.
